In the present work an effort will be made to apply radiation exchange calculations which account for radiation configuration factors in a flat plate night sky radiator with a cover partly transparent at long wave-lengths when the sky radiation must be taken into account. The objective of the analysis will be to estimate the influence of the radiation configuration factors |
